Description
This traverse has some of the coolest movements on Flagstaff, along with some of the hardest moves as well. Normally finishing the traverse by sitting on the ground just around the corner for "Over Yourself" (FA by Skip Guerin), I added an additional crimpy crux continuing around the corner to the end before topping out on the classic boulder problem "North Overhang". Start with of your both hands in the two pockets just to the left of "Crystal Mantel," and traverse left, staying relatively low. It's about 44 moves to the end.
The grades are subjective, so don't lose your marbles, but this is definitely one of the harder climbs on Flagstaff.
